How did world war 1 hurt business in Europe even after the war
soldier1979 [14.2K]
Post-war, all of the combatants were rather weighed down by large amounts of debt they had accumulated during the war. This, combined with rapid overproduction of currency, caused hyperinflation and doomed global economies, later leading to the Great Depression.

The music played during the earliest films (pre-1900)
Firdavs [7]

The correct answer is option A. Conveyed the mood of each scene.


The phonograph was not used to play sound on films until the beggining of the 20th century. Instead, a group of musicians would be brought along with film presentations, as well as a "rancoteur" - a person who would explain the actions and themes of the film to the audiences. The primary purpose of live music during films was to set the mood in accordance the events on screen.

What were five similarities between the totalitarian Governments in italy Germany and the Soviet Union
jeka94
  1. They were totalitarian regimes that were led by a single party strongly linked to state institutions.
  2. They were led by a charismatic character with unlimited power.  
  3. They made intense use of propaganda and were the sole owners of the media.  
  4. They used the indoctrination of the masses to achieve a perfect society.  
  5. They used mechanisms of social control such as repression through a secret police.
